LOUD Scavenge Pump
I just bought a tilton scavenge pump and hooked it up and started the car for the first time. The thing is pretty loud...Can anyone confirm that these pumps are supposed to be loud.
By loud I mean maybe a little louder than a external fuel pump.

Not sure with that brand but most pumps running full speed will be loud if you slow them down a bit it will last longer and run quiter. Pm me for a link from a non-sponcer for a PWM controller

thanks for the responses guys...I hooked mine up again today and started the car. I hooked it to the fuel pump wire so it primes for 2 seconds then shuts off when ignition on but runs constantly when the fuel pump is running.
I have borla also and I can't hear it when the car is idle but I can hear it very well with just the ignition on and not the engine.
